H/t to Luke Gromen. The Egyptian stock market is not part of my database, so I ended up having to dive through some hoops to put this together. Despite the war on its border, the Egyptian stock market has made new all-time highs this year.
I have plotted 2 charts; the top one in blue is the price of the top 30 stocks. The orange line is the cumulative return. This is what you get if you invested in the local Egyptian currency.
Now let us go a little deeper than the headline news. We have been hearing for sometime that emerging markets are the place to be. So wearing our global investor hat, let us say we decided to go and invest in the Egyptian markets in 2021. How did we do?
It turns out that if we adjust the returns for US dollars, then we have lost 10% since 2021. It is so important to look at the “real” returns, not the headline returns that don’t paint the full picture. Be very careful when financial advisors or sellers of investment products try to pull this headline angle on you.
I am not saying that Egyptians living in Egypt have not achieved the returns in the top plot. The problem is that today we are part of a global village. If your currency devalues, then you are poorer relative to the world than you were before, and most people need things from the world. This is not always bad for the economy, as a weaker currency makes exporting more attractive and can lead to more manufacturing jobs or foreign earnings.
If you were a global macro investor using your US dollars to invest in this market, you would have lost money. That is my point.

Cocoa Update
I made a call for a top in cocoa yesterday. It seemed like every person in the financial media world was posting a picture of cocoa. Yesterday, the price surged over $10,000 a ton and then ended the day slightly down. This adds to my conviction of a near-term pullback.
Of course, now everyone is talking about supply shortages and trying to fit a narrative that explains why this is sustainable. Suddenly, everyone is an expert in cocoa. Yes, most are experts in eating chocolate but know nothing about the demand-supply dynamics of this market, me included.
I love it when everyone expects one thing and the opposite happens. Remember, the markets are trading future expectations. Players familiar with the space have known about the poor crops for years. I had no clue. Entering this parabolic bull market now is such a low-probability trade.
